Chinaunix首页 | 论坛 | 博客
  • 博客访问: 1562215
  • 博文数量: 237
  • 博客积分: 5139
  • 博客等级: 大校
  • 技术积分: 2751
  • 用 户 组: 普通用户
  • 注册时间: 2008-11-18 14:48
文章分类

全部博文(237)

文章存档

2016年(1)

2012年(4)

2011年(120)

2010年(36)

2009年(64)

2008年(12)

分类: Java

2011-05-12 10:20:51

在Android中可以使用Log类,Log类在android.util包中。Log 类提供了若干静态方法 :

Log.v(String tag, String msg);

Log.d(String tag, String msg);

Log.i(String tag, String msg);

Log.w(String tag, String msg);

Log.e(String tag, String msg);

分别对应 Verbose,Debug,Info,Warning,Error。

tag是一个标识,可以是任意字符串,通常可以使用类名+方法名, 主要是用来在查看日志时提供一个筛选条件. 通过使用android.util.Log类可以帮助你自己查找错误和打印系统日志消息。它是一个进行日志输出的API,我们在Android 程序中可以随时为某一个对象插入一个Log,然后在DDMS中观察Logcat的输出是否正常。查看Log有两个方法,首先你可以使用cmd指令调出控制台然后

使用"adb logcat" 命令:

adb logcat

当执行 adb logcat 后会以tail方式实时显示出所有的日志信息.

这时候我们通常需要对信息进行过滤,来显示我们需要的信息, 这时候我们指定的 tag就派上了用场.

adb logcat -s MyAndroid:I

解释:只显示tag为MyAndroid,级别为I或级别高于I(Warning,Error)的日志信息。

还有一种更好的方法,如果你的IDE用的是Eclipse的话,在show view中选择Locat就可以直接看到输出。



阅读(597)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~